Description:

Vulnerability in the Oracle GlassFish Server component of Oracle Fusion Middleware (subcomponent: Administration). Supported versions that are affected are 3.0.1 and 3.1.2. Easily exploitable vulnerability allows low privileged attacker with logon to the infrastructure where Oracle GlassFish Server executes to compromise Oracle GlassFish Server. Successful attacks of this vulnerability can result in unauthorized read access to a subset of Oracle GlassFish Server accessible data. CVSS v3.0 Base Score 3.3 (Confidentiality impacts).
